Importance of Strength Training for Overall Health

Strength training offers a myriad of benefits that extend well beyond muscle growth. It improves cardiovascular health, promotes metabolic rate, aids in weight management, and strengthens bones, which is crucial in preventing osteoporosis as we age. Furthermore, strength training can enhance your insulin sensitivity and can serve as a preventive measure against chronic illnesses such as type 2 diabetes. For many, regular strength training also provides mental fortitude, bolstering confidence and self-esteem while reducing stress levels.

Key Exercises Every Beginner Should Know

When starting strength training, familiarity with fundamental exercises is important. Here are some key exercises that every beginner should incorporate into their routine:

  • Squats: Excellent for building leg strength and targeting the quadriceps, hamstrings, and glutes.
  • Bench Press: A staple upper body exercise that primarily targets the chest, triceps, and shoulders.
  • Deadlifts: Effective for overall body strength, focusing primarily on back and leg muscles.
  • Pull-Ups: Great for strengthening the upper body and improving grip strength.
  • Planks: Essential for core stability and strength, targeting the abs and lower back.

Mastering these exercises not only lays a solid foundation for strength training but also enhances your approach to advanced techniques.

Common Mistakes to Avoid in Strength Training

As you begin your strength training journey, it’s crucial to steer clear of common pitfalls that can hinder progress or lead to injury:

  • Neglecting Form: Proper technique is vital. Performing exercises incorrectly can lead to injuries and muscle imbalances.
  • Skipping Warm-Ups: Always prepare your muscles for exertion to prevent injuries.
  • Overtraining: Rest days are essential; your muscles need time to recover and grow stronger.
  • Ignoring Nutrition: Fueling your body with the right nutrients will support your strength training efforts.

By avoiding these mistakes, you can cultivate a more productive and safe strength training environment.

High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T)

High-Intensity Interval Training mixes short bursts of intense activity with periods of lower-intensity exercise or complete rest. This method effectively builds strength and endurance while improving cardiovascular health.

For example, a HIIT workout might include 30 seconds of sprinting followed by 1 minute of walking, repeated for a total of 20 minutes. This format not only maximizes calorie burn during workouts but also elevates your metabolism for hours after the session, making it an efficient option for strength training aficionados.

Progressive Overload Methodology

The concept of progressive overload is foundational for gaining strength. This involves gradually increasing the stress placed on the musculoskeletal system during training to induce muscle growth. Here’s how you can implement it:

  • Increase Weight: Gradually add weight to your exercises while maintaining proper form.
  • Increase Repetitions: Perform more repetitions at a given weight over time.
  • Increase Sets: Add more sets to your routine for greater volume.
  • Alter Frequency: Increase the number of times you train a specific muscle group each week.

By applying these techniques consistently, you will challenge your muscles appropriately, leading to adaptation and growth.

Essential Nutrients for Recovery and Muscle Building

The right nutrients are vital for your recovery and muscle-building processes. Key nutrients include:

  • Proteins: Essential for muscle repair and growth; aim for a source of protein in each meal.
  • Carbohydrates: Your primary energy source; ensure adequate carbohydrate intake to fuel workouts.
  • Fats: Important for hormonal balance; include sources of healthy fats like avocados, nuts, and olive oil.

Additionally, consider consuming branched-chain amino acids (BCAAs) and omega-3 fatty acids for enhanced recovery and performance.

Meal Timing and Its Impact on Performance

When you eat can be just as important as what you eat. Nutrition plays a crucial role in your pre- and post-workout strategy:

  • Pre-Workout: A balanced meal rich in carbohydrates and protein 1 to 2 hours before your workout can enhance your performance.
  • Post-Workout: Consume protein-fueled meals or snacks within 30-60 minutes after exercise to aid recovery.

These strategies help ensure your body has the necessary resources to support intense training and recovery.

SMART Goals for Fitness Progression

Setting SMART (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, Time-bound) goals allows you to structure your fitness journey effectively:

  • Specific: Define clear objectives, such as “I want to squat 200 lbs”.
  • Measurable: Ensure that you can track your progress with metrics such as weight, reps, or performance times.
  • Achievable: Set realistic goals based on your current fitness level.
  • Relevant: Align your goals with your overall fitness aspirations and lifestyle.
  • Time-bound: Create a timeline for achieving your goals to maintain motivation.

Following these guidelines will keep you focused and on track throughout your training endeavors.
